ō(o1) , ò(o4) , (wo1) , (wu1) , o // pronunciations of 喔 in Mandarin Pinyin

Basic information about 喔

Unihan definition: descriptive of crying or of crowing

Number of strokes: 12

Radical:  30.9

Frequency rank: 2860

General standard index number: 5161

English translation (based on CEDICT):

喔[ō]:
- I see
- oh
喔[wo]:
- (particle) marker of surprise, sudden realization, reminder

Details

Unicode code point: U+5594
